Stocks bounce as Fed delivers fourth 0.75% hike

Stocks bounce as Fed delivers fourth 0.75% hike

U.S. stocks were firmly higher Wednesday afternoon following a move by the Federal Reserve to raise its benchmark policy rate by 75 basis points for a fourth straight time — on par with market expectations — while hinting at a potential slower pace of monetary tightening ahead. The S&P 500 (^GSPC) gained 0.6%, while the Dow Jones Industrial Average (^DJI) jumped 280 points, or 0.9%. Wall Street Sees S&P 500 Falling Further After Bear-Market Bounce

Wall Street Sees S&P 500 Falling Further After Bear-Market Bounce

(Bloomberg) — Some of Wall Street’s biggest banks aren’t buying this stock-market rally. Most Read from Bloomberg Firms from HSBC Holdings Plc to Credit Suisse Group AG are skeptical that the S&P 500 Index has reached its ultimate low and warning that US equity prices still don’t fully reflect the risks of higher interest rates on earnings and valuations.
